✕
Menu
Home
Arts & Entertainment
Business
Education
Event
Contact Us
Search
Menu
Tag:
T20 World Cup 2024 Venue
Sports
December 13, 2023
ICC Men’s T20 World Cup 2024: Schedule, Venue, and Teams Full List